Transaction c08b916463936d2b3d43c8ca554b2bc8ce7819cebbe177e66dc58fe98829e871
3 Input
2 Outputs
- c08b916463936d2b3d43c8ca554b2bc8ce7819cebbe177e66dc58fe98829e871:0
- c08b916463936d2b3d43c8ca554b2bc8ce7819cebbe177e66dc58fe98829e871:1
value 34406037
address 115Qx8CW8oCMfifHCvR1EEvj3BsPBgzboD
value 26356105
address 16yqwoexCwiTmpPjkWiPA8GuSgb1w43TBs